The Core Technology: How Eight Sleep Cracks the Code on Sleep Temperature
Let’s get down to brass tacks: the absolute game-changer with the Eight Sleep Pod is its active temperature regulation. This isn’t just a marketing buzzword. it’s the core engineering marvel that sets it light-years apart from even the best “cooling” mattresses on the market. Most so-called cooling mattresses rely on passive technologies—gel infusions, breathable foams, open-cell structures—which might help dissipate heat, but they don’t actively remove or add heat to create your ideal sleep climate. Think of it this way: a breathable shirt is great, but an air-conditioned room actively controls the temperature. The Eight Sleep Pod is that air-conditioned room for your bed.
Here’s how it works: Best Oled Gaming
- The Hub: This is the brains and brawn of the operation, typically sitting beside your bed. It houses the water reservoir, pump, and thermoelectric units. It’s surprisingly compact given its capabilities, about the size of a small desktop computer.
- The Active Grid: This is the magic layer that goes over your mattress or is integrated into the Pod mattress itself. It’s a grid of thin, medical-grade tubing through which water circulates. This water is precisely heated or cooled by the Hub and then flows through the grid, directly affecting the surface temperature of your sleep.
- Temperature Range: We’re talking serious range here, from a chilly 55°F 12.8°C up to a toasty 110°F 43.3°C. This allows for incredible customization, whether you’re a hot sleeper craving Antarctic chills or someone who loves to be bundled up in a desert warmth.
- Dual-Zone Control: This is a godsend for couples. Each side of the bed can be set to a completely different temperature. No more fighting over the thermostat – one partner can be blissfully cool while the other is cozily warm. This alone can save relationships, or at least a good night’s sleep.
Why is this critical for sleep?
Your core body temperature naturally dips as you fall asleep and reaches its lowest point in the early morning hours.
A bedroom that’s too warm can significantly disrupt this process, leading to fragmented sleep and difficulty reaching deeper sleep stages.
Conversely, some people find a slightly warmer environment conducive to falling asleep, then prefer it cooler for the rest of the night.

Potential Drawbacks and Considerations Before Buying
No product is perfect, and the Eight Sleep Pod, while impressive, does have a few considerations worth noting before you pull the trigger.
Being aware of these can help manage expectations and ensure it’s the right fit for your needs. Best Low Price Monitor For Gaming
- The “Hub” Factor: The brains of the operation, the Hub, sits next to your bed. While relatively quiet, it does emit a very subtle hum or gurgle as the water circulates and the pump operates. For extremely light sleepers, this might be a minor distraction, especially in a perfectly silent room. Most users report it fades into the background noise, but it’s something to be aware of.
- Required Maintenance: This isn’t a set-it-and-forget-it mattress. The Hub requires distilled water refills every 1-3 months depending on usage and environment to prevent mineral buildup and ensure optimal performance. It’s a quick process, but it is an ongoing task.
- Temperature Transition Speed: While effective, the temperature changes aren’t instantaneous. It takes some time for the water to heat or cool and circulate through the entire grid to reach the desired surface temperature. If you need rapid, minute-by-minute adjustments, you might find a slight delay.
- Feel of the Active Grid: The Active Grid is integrated into the Pod Cover or mattress. While generally comfortable and unobtrusive, some highly sensitive individuals might feel the subtle texture of the embedded tubes, particularly if they are lying directly on the cover without a sheet. This is a rare complaint, but worth mentioning.
- Reliance on Technology and App: The full functionality of the Eight Sleep Pod relies on the companion app and consistent Wi-Fi connectivity. If you’re someone who prefers a low-tech bedroom or is uncomfortable with smart devices, this system might feel overly complex. Issues with Wi-Fi or app glitches though rare could temporarily impact your ability to control the system.
- Power Outages: In the event of a power outage, the active temperature regulation and tracking features will cease to function. It will revert to being a standard mattress until power is restored.
- Cost of Entry: We’ve covered this, but it bears repeating: it’s a significant investment. This puts it out of reach for many budgets, and potential buyers need to seriously weigh the benefits against the cost.
- Long-Term Durability of the Hub: While built with quality components, any complex electronic and mechanical system like the Hub has a finite lifespan. While Eight Sleep offers warranties, consider the potential for repair or replacement down the line, much like any other appliance.

Comparing Eight Sleep Pod with Traditional “Cooling” Mattresses
When people talk about mattresses, “cooling” is a buzzword that gets thrown around a lot.
But there’s a fundamental difference between a traditional “cooling” mattress and the active temperature regulation of the Eight Sleep Pod. Rogue Gear
Understanding this distinction is crucial for setting proper expectations and making an informed buying decision.
Traditional “Cooling” Mattresses e.g., Casper, Tempur-Pedic Breeze, Bear:
- Mechanism: These mattresses primarily use passive cooling technologies. This means they are designed to dissipate heat away from your body or prevent heat buildup.
- Materials: Common approaches include:
- Gel Infusions: Gel beads or swirls added to foam are meant to absorb and draw heat away.
- Phase-Change Materials PCMs: These materials can absorb and release heat as they change states solid to liquid and vice-versa to help regulate temperature.
- Open-Cell Foams: Foams designed with a more porous structure to allow for better airflow.
- Breathable Covers: Fabrics like Tencel, cotton, or specialized weaves designed to wick away moisture and enhance airflow.
- Hybrid Designs: Combining foam layers with innerspring coils allows for more air circulation within the mattress.
- Materials: Common approaches include:
- Effectiveness: They can feel cooler than traditional memory foam, and they generally help prevent you from overheating as much. They are effective at managing heat buildup.
- Limitations: They don’t actively cool or heat the surface below ambient room temperature. If your room is 75°F, the mattress can’t make your sleep surface 65°F. They rely on your body heat and the surrounding air to work. They are also not customizable – the cooling is uniform across the bed.
Eight Sleep Pod Active Temperature Regulation:
- Mechanism: The Eight Sleep Pod uses active temperature regulation. This means it has an external unit the Hub that precisely heats or cools water, which then circulates through a grid embedded in the mattress cover.
- Direct Control: You set a specific temperature e.g., 62°F or 98°F, and the system works to achieve and maintain that temperature on the mattress surface.
- Energy Transfer: It actively adds or removes heat from your body via the circulating water, providing a much more profound and precise temperature change.
- Effectiveness: It can genuinely make your bed feel significantly cooler or warmer than your room’s ambient temperature. This level of control is unparalleled in the mattress market.
- Advantages:
- True Customization: Set specific temperatures for each side of the bed.
- Dynamic Changes: Schedule temperature adjustments throughout the night to match your sleep cycles.
- Proactive, Not Reactive: It doesn’t just dissipate heat. it actively creates the desired thermal environment.
- Paired with Data: The temperature control is integrated with sleep tracking, allowing you to see how different temperatures impact your sleep quality.
